Subject: Re: [PATCH] bpf: fix unused variable warning

On Wed, Apr 29, 2020 at 6:23 AM Arnd Bergmann <arnd@...db.de> wrote:
>
> Hiding the only using of bpf_link_type_strs[] in an #ifdef causes
> an unused-variable warning:
>
> kernel/bpf/syscall.c:2280:20: error: 'bpf_link_type_strs' defined but not used [-Werror=unused-variable]
>  2280 | static const char *bpf_link_type_strs[] = {
>
> Move the definition into the same #ifdef.
>
> Fixes: f2e10bff16a0 ("bpf: Add support for BPF_OBJ_GET_INFO_BY_FD for bpf_link")
> Signed-off-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@...db.de>
